Transaction 5e7eecca7c29694a64c3a72225dbbe24d03e01e1f8274e7c63b07126b3a10512
1 Input
1 Output
-
5e7eecca7c29694a64c3a72225dbbe24d03e01e1f8274e7c63b07126b3a10512:0
- value
- 17077570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ac143654ab785236183ba03133eed19d4dd4cee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Defme6fjx1GriR1H6jCjuw4qY79t2JxCQ